    David Freiburger and Scotto on How Roadkill Happened, Road Trip Therapy & Why Old Cars Just Win

    12-08-2026 | 2 u. 41 Min.
    “Don’t get it right; just get it running!” - words we could all stand to live by! This week we welcome David Freiburger, colossus of the automotive world who alongside Scotto, forms a mildly senior (sorry.. ‘Authoritative’ ! ) coalition of men yelling at clouds. Though you may know him best from his adventures with Roadkill alongside Mike Finnegan, David’s roots in the car world go back to magazines, with storied career chapters spent at the wheel of multiple titles. Making the jump to video, he put in time at MotorTrend and now, his own YouTube channel. In this hugely wide-ranging conversation, the gents litigate everything from the glory days of heavy metal (Dokken anyone?), to Drag Week and countless records and tales from the drag-strip, even including hearing damage. Crucially though, could David be the guest that finally causes the blind to see and the lame to walk? By which of course I mean poor Scotto, and his unfinished projects – dear Lord, we need a miracle! As ever, enjoy.

    The First Automotive Influencer? | RJ de Vera's life in Cars from The Fast and the Furious to SEMA

    22-07-2026 | 3 u. 9 Min.
    Very Vehicular welcomes RJ de Vera! Each season we like to bring on a guest from inside the automotive industry whose position and experience helps us better understand the issues facing car culture, and while RJ is more than qualified in that regard, there’s more that he’s done… much more! He was a foundational part of the import scene in the 90s, working as a writer and photographer for Super Street before ascending to Editor at Large. He was the go-to guy on the scene consulting for a plethora of OEMs and brands looking to break off a little piece of the magic for themselves. He even had a role in a notable movie franchise - word to the wise is he’s still collecting residual checks for his on-screen role to this day. Trading the underground for a storied chapter in the corporate world (twelve years at 3M / Meguiars no less), he’s now taken his rightful place atop the mountain as Vice President of Marketing at SEMA. Of most interest to us though? He’s a fully paid-up, card-carrying car nerd, with extraordinary stories and an insight into car culture you won’t want to miss. Enjoy!
